There is no real way to date pieces of Ken Edwards pottery, but it is known that most pieces are signed with a KE for Ken Edwards, and usually by another signature, an animal, fish, or insect.

An exhibition at the Regional Museum of Ceramics in Tlaquepaque honors Ken Edwards, the internationally famed U.S.-born ceramicist who installed the first high-temperature kiln in Mexico and produced ceramics renowned for incorporating traditional Tonala designs. Edwards died July 31 aged 96. See item details. Most pieces are signed with a KE for Ken Edwards and usually by another signature, an animal, fish, or insect. Scorpion, Swan, Bird, Snail, Spider, Crane, Swallow, Fish, and Mouse are all signatures of the talented artists at Ken Edward's shop. Every piece of Ken Edwards is different. Ken Edwards had a fairly large staff of artists and they each used an animal or insect as their signatures; often times you see a bird, other times a scorpion, or butterfly, etc. With a familiar KE mark or El Palomar signature this pottery is one of a kind.
